The genusTakifugu comprises approximately 25 speciesthat are closely related due to fairly recent speciation in the northwesternPacific. The variety of coloration patterns within Takifugu has led to taxonomic confusion. A recent study treated Takifugu niphobles (Jordan and Snyder, 1901)as a junior synonym of Takifugu alboplumbeus(Richardson, 1845) based on morphological comparison of the type specimens. Inan attempt to review the taxonomic status of grass puffer at a molecular level,209 individuals from nine localities in the northwestern Pacific (twolocalities in the East Sea, five in the Korea Strait, and two in the Yellow Sea)were analyzed using m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A) and microsatellites. The mtDNA sequenceanalyses showed two distinct lineages (Kimura-two-parameter distance=1.5–2.6%and 2.2–3.6% in cytochrome c oxidase subunit I and cytochrome b, respectively).The distributions of the two lineages tended to be separated; lineage 1 waslocated in the East Sea and lineage 2 in the Yellow Sea, but both lineages in theKorea Strait. STRUCTURE analyses using 13 microsatellite markers showed two distinctgroups, which was consistent with the two subdivisions in mtDNA, except for thewestern Korea Strait. Our findings suggest that T. niphobles is a distinct species differing from T. alboplumbeus, unlike previous study. Thisrequires further careful taxonomic revision.
